Golden Glory Cornelian Cherry (Cornus mas 'Golden Glory'): Golden Glory is a multi-stemmed upright form of Cornelian cherry that was introduced by the Synnesvedt Nursery Company of Illinois. Each umbel is surrounded at the base by small, yellowish, petaloid bracts which are much less showy than the large decorative bracts found on some other species of dogwood such as Cornus florida (flowering dogwood) and Cornus kousa (kousa dogwood). 4.8 na 45 ocen. Fruits may be used for making syrups and preserves.Genus name comes from the Latin word cornu meaning horn in probable reference to the strength and density of the wood. Add to quote. It typically grows over time to 15-25' tall with a spread to 12-20' wide. Common name refers to the cherry-like fruits which resemble in color the semi-precious gemstone carnelian (or cornelian).
